CVE-2018-4283: Input Validation
IOGraphics. An out-of-bounds read issue existed that led to the disclosure of kernel memory. This was addressed with improved input validation.
Other sources
An out-of-bounds read issue existed that led to the disclosure of kernel memory. This was addressed with improved input validation. This issue affected versions prior to macOS High Sierra 10.13.6.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is CVE-2018-4283?
CVE-2018-4283 is a vulnerability that allows an attacker to read kernel memory out-of-bounds, leading to potential disclosure of sensitive information.
Which versions of macOS High Sierra are affected by CVE-2018-4283?
Versions prior to macOS High Sierra 10.13.6 are affected by CVE-2018-4283.
How can the CVE-2018-4283 vulnerability be fixed?
The CVE-2018-4283 vulnerability can be fixed by updating macOS High Sierra to version 10.13.6 or later.
What is the severity of CVE-2018-4283?
CVE-2018-4283 has a severity rating of 5.5 out of 10 (medium).
What is the Common Weakness Enumeration (CWE) ID for CVE-2018-4283?
The CWE IDs associated with CVE-2018-4283 are CWE-20 and CWE-125.
